I wanted to update this post with my troubleshooting. I think I nailed it to be the Station ID not being there initially. I mostly think that I did not have the password correct too. Once one has the correct LotW account setup (user, password, tqsl path, temp path), Log40M allows to use the Station ID pulldown. In there you will see all of the LotW ID you have under your Tqsl software.

I did a test log and quit Log40M....after a few minutes my test log appeared on LotW website!
